Job description

Assembly Supervisor Night Shift - 6:30 PM - 5:30 AM

Job Category: Operations / Manufacturing

Locations

Showing 1 location

Description
Essential Duties and Responsibilities
Supervision of Assembly Operations
  • Lead and manage the assembly team, ensuring all injection-molded parts are properly assembled, inspected, and prepared for painting or coating.
  • Ensure assembly operations run efficiently and effectively while meeting established production schedules.
  • Monitor daily workflow and allocate resources to achieve production objectives.
Quality Control and Standards
  • Maintain and enforce strict quality control processes throughout the assembly operation.
  • Ensure all parts meet Toyoda Gosei and customer specifications before progressing to the painting or coating stage.
  • Address and resolve quality concerns promptly in collaboration with the Quality Assurance team.
  • Promote a culture of quality and accountability among team members.
Workplace Safety
  • Prioritize and enforce a culture of safety within the assembly department.
  • Ensure all safety standards, procedures, and regulations are followed at all times.
  • Maintain assembly work areas in a safe and organized manner to prevent accidents and injuries.
  • Conduct safety observations, investigations, and corrective actions as needed.
  • Foster an environment of continuous improvement within the assembly department.
  • Collaborate with cross-functional teams to identify opportunities for efficiency improvements, waste reduction, and process optimization.
  • Participate in Lean Manufacturing, Six Sigma, and other continuous improvement initiatives to enhance assembly line performance.
  • Implement and sustain best practices to improve productivity and quality.
Training and Development
  • Oversee the training and development of assembly team members.
  • Ensure employees are knowledgeable in product specifications, assembly processes, safety practices, and quality standards.
  • Promote a culture of teamwork, accountability, and professional growth.
  • Provide coaching, performance feedback, and developmental opportunities.
Collaboration with Other Departments
  • Work closely with Production Planning, Engineering, Quality Control, and Logistics teams to ensure smooth transitions between assembly, painting/coating, and shipping processes.
  • Coordinate with the Shipping Department to ensure timely and accurate delivery of completed products to customers.
  • Support cross-functional problem-solving and communication initiatives.
Performance Metrics
  • Monitor and report on key performance indicators (KPIs), including:
    • Assembly throughput
    • Quality performance
    • Scrap and rework rates
    • Downtime
    • Productivity
    • On-time delivery performance
  • Take proactive measures to meet or exceed production targets and maintain operational efficiency.
Required Experience, Skills, and Qualifications
  • Previous supervisory or leadership experience in a manufacturing environment.
  • Experience with assembly operations and injection-molded products preferred.
  • Strong knowledge of quality systems, manufacturing processes, and safety regulations.
  • Experience with Lean Manufacturing, Six Sigma, or continuous improvement methodologies preferred.
  • Excellent communication, leadership, and interpersonal skills.
  • Strong problem-solving and decision-making abilities.
  • Proficiency with Microsoft Office and manufacturing systems.
  • Ability to work in a fast-paced manufacturing environment and manage multiple priorities.
